Publisher's summary

From #1 New York Times bestselling author Brandon Sanderson, a special gift edition of Edgedancer, a short novel of the Stormlight Archive (previously published in Arcanum Unbounded).

Three years ago, Lift asked a goddess to stop her from growing older—a wish she believed was granted. Now, in Edgedancer, the barely teenage nascent Knight Radiant finds that time stands still for no one. Although the young Azish emperor granted her safe haven from an executioner she knows only as Darkness, court life is suffocating the free-spirited Lift, who can't help heading to Yeddaw when she hears the relentless Darkness is there hunting people like her with budding powers. The downtrodden in Yeddaw have no champion, and Lift knows she must seize this awesome responsibility.

Good story, great reading, fills in some gaps in the series!

I listened to this novella after already listening through books 1-4 of the Stormlight Archive. I went with just the title novels for my first listen through, and on my second run I’m including both Edgedancer (book 2.5) and Dawnshard (book 3.5). I have to say that Lift isn’t one of my favorite characters from this series, but she is one of Brandon Sanderson’s, and you can tell that by how much fun he had writing this story. Lift has so much personality, wit, and general mischievousness it’s hard not to like her the more time you spend with her. Having listened through Stormlight (as of what’s available in 2023) without including Edgedancer, I wouldn’t say it’s strictly necessary for someone looking to enjoy the main series. That said, I would certainly recommend it for fans of Stormlight, as it does provide some interesting additional info on characters, places, and themes! Plus, if you’re able to shrug off the 220 hour main story, what’s another 8 going to hurt?
